NTT DATA's Client is seeking an experienced Senior Network Security Architect to design, implement, manage, and optimize enterprise network security infrastructure with a strong focus on Palo Alto Networks NGFW, Panorama, Strata Cloud Manager (SCM), and Zscaler (ZIA/ZPA) technologies. The ideal candidate will serve as a senior technical resource responsible for securing enterprise networks, cloud environments, remote access, and Zero Trust architectures while ensuring operational excellence and compliance with security standards.
The role requires hands-on expertise in enterprise security operations, firewall policy management, threat prevention, cloud security, secure remote access, and troubleshooting complex network security issues. Experience with Palo Alto centralized management platforms including Panorama and Strata Cloud Manager, along with Zscaler Internet Access (ZIA) and Zscaler Private Access (ZPA), is essential.
